    Product Description

  • Manufactured from case-hardened chromoly steel for the ultimate in strength and durability
  • Parkerizing surface treatment for rust and corrosion resistance
  • The excellent OE quality you expect from the SUNSTAR brand.

    This item fits the following models:
  • 1983-1986 Suzuki ALT125
  • 1983-1990 Suzuki DR100
  • 1982-1984 Suzuki DR125
  • 1982-1983 Suzuki GN125E
  • 1991-1997 Suzuki GN125E
  • 1983-1987 Suzuki LT125
  • 1977-1981 Suzuki RM100
  • 1976-1979 Suzuki RM125
  • 1983 Suzuki SP100
  • 1982-1983 Suzuki SP125

    Honda Insight ramps up left-handed models to meet U.S. demand

    Thu, 26 Mar 2009

    Honda's new Insight hybrid hatchback has been on sale barely a week in the United States. But the company's sprawling plant here is already churning out 600 a day. And about half of the sleek-silhouetted Insights rolling down Suzuka's Line 1 have left-handed steering wheels, attesting to Honda's optimism for booming business in North America.

    Toyota eyes turbos, direct injection

    Mon, 22 Nov 2010

    Toyota Motor Corp. plans to introduce 11 new or redesigned hybrid vehicles by 2012, but the carmaker is hardly neglecting the humble internal combustion engine. Takeshi Uchiyamada, executive vice president in charge of r&d, also wants to increase the fleet's fuel efficiency by putting turbochargers and direct fuel injection in smaller vehicles.
